Overview

Object describing how to split the graph to display multiple visualizations per request.

Constructor Details

#initialize(attributes = {}) ⇒ NotebookSplitBy

Initializes the object

Parameters:

  • attributes (Hash) (defaults to: {})

    attributes Model attributes in the form of hash

# File 'lib/datadog_api_client/v1/models/notebook_split_by.rb', line 65

def initialize(attributes = {})
  if (!attributes.is_a?(Hash))
    fail ArgumentError, "The input argument (attributes) must be a hash in `DatadogAPIClient::V1::NotebookSplitBy` initialize method"
  end

  # check to see if the attribute exists and convert string to symbol for hash key
  attributes = attributes.each_with_object({}) { |(k, v), h|
    if (!self.class.attribute_map.key?(k.to_sym))
      fail ArgumentError, "`#{k}` is not a valid attribute in `DatadogAPIClient::V1::NotebookSplitBy`. Please check the name to make sure it's valid. List of attributes: " + self.class.attribute_map.keys.inspect
    end
    h[k.to_sym] = v
  }

  if attributes.key?(:'keys')
    if (value = attributes[:'keys']).is_a?(Array)
      self.keys = value
    end
  end

  if attributes.key?(:'tags')
    if (value = attributes[:'tags']).is_a?(Array)
      self.tags = value
    end
  end
end
